WWE announces brand-to-brand invitation, McIntyre vs. Corbin set


A match between a Raw and SmackDown star is set for next week’s Raw following the announcement of the brand-to-brand invitation.
After defeating Andrade on tonight’s episode of Raw, McIntyre explained that there was a “brand-to-brand invitation” between Raw and SmackDown. He went on to say that Raw extended an invitation to a SmackDown wrestler, which ended up being Corbin, and he accepted the invitation, choosing McIntyre as his opponent.
No details were made as to what exactly the brand-to-brand invitation was, or if there were any limitations. After the segment aired it was announced that Charlotte, who is on the Raw brand, would appear on SmackDown this Friday.
For several months last year, a Wild Card rule was introduced in WWE where four stars could appear on an opposite brand for one night only appearances. However, the rules were quickly dropped, with stars competing on both brands until a WWE Draft was held in October.
